Lets compare vitamin content per 1 pound of Stewed Canned Tomatoes vs Coconut Water:
- 1 pound of Stewed Canned Tomatoes has 1.5 times more Vitamin B1, 8.9 times more Vitamin B3, 2.7 times more Vitamin B5, 3.3 times more Vitamin C, more Vitamin E and more Vitamin K than Coconut Water.
- While 1 lb of Coconut Water (liquid From Coconuts) contains 1.6 times more Vitamin B2 and 1.9 times more Vitamin B6 than Stewed Canned Ripe Red Tomatoes.
- 1 pound of Stewed Canned Tomatoes have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B6
- 1 pound of Coconut Water have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B3, Vitamin B5, Vitamin E and Vitamin K
- Both Stewed Canned Ripe Red Tomatoes as well as Coconut Water (liquid From Coconuts) have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A, Vitamin B9, Vitamin B12 and Vitamin D in one pound.
Comparing minerals per 1 pound for Stewed Canned Tomatoes vs Coconut Water:
- 1 pound of Stewed Canned Tomatoes has 1.4 times more Calcium, 2.8 times more Copper, 4.6 times more Iron and 2.1 times more Sodium than Coconut Water.
- While 1 lb of Coconut Water (liquid From Coconuts) contains 2.1 times more Magnesium and 2.4 times more Manganese than Stewed Canned Ripe Red Tomatoes.
- Both Stewed Canned Tomatoes and Coconut Water contain similar levels of Phosphorus, Potassium and Water per one pound.
- Both Stewed Canned Ripe Red Tomatoes as well as Coconut Water (liquid From Coconuts) lack sufficient amounts of Selenium and Zinc in one pound.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 1 pound:
- 1 pound of Stewed Canned Tomatoes has 1.7 times more Carbohydrate and 1.3 times more Sugars than Coconut Water.
- Both Stewed Canned Tomatoes and Coconut Water offer comparable quantities of Fiber per one pound.
- Both Stewed Canned Ripe Red Tomatoes as well as Coconut Water (liquid From Coconuts) provide inadequate amounts of Energy, Omega 3, Omega 6 and Protein in one pound.
